8. There's An Awesome Homage To The Hitchhiker's Guide To The Galaxy

Continuing what begun in the first game, Fallout 2 contained a huge amount of brilliant hidden easter eggs. The very best of all these was a reference to a memorable moment in a certain science fiction book by Douglas Adams. As part of a special encounter, it's possible to come across what appears to be a splattered whale that's caused deep indentations in the earth around it. Surrounded by blood and a pot of daisies, those not in the know might think this to be a wholly random occurrence. In fact, it's a direct nod to a passage from The Hitchhiker's Guide To The Galaxy, in which the Infinite Improbability Drive transformed two nuclear missiles into a surprised sperm whale and a bowl of petunias.
